SOAR Bios
Chip Smith, President
As a California native, Chip developed an early love for outdoor sports through water and snow skiing, road and mountain biking, surfing and a few years of football and cross-country running.
His passion for sports helped him develop into a successful marketing professional with more than 15 years of experience in the sporting goods, healthcare, software and communications industries. The majority of those years were spent with sporting goods industry leaders Shimano American Corporation and Specialized Bicycles, Inc.
Chip began his career in 1988 with the Los Angeles office of Ogilvy & Mather advertising, where he spent three years as a billing supervisor. He then spent seven years in sales and marketing positions with Shimano American Corporation, the world’s dominant leader in bicycle components. As marketing manager, Chip directed the company’s strategy and execution of advertising, collateral, point-of-purchase, trade show, advocacy efforts, governmental outreach, promotional efforts, as well as product launches to the trade, government and consumers in the U.S. market.
Specialized Bicycles recruited Chip away from Shimano to become its global marcom manager, a position he held for nearly three years as he directed a team in all aspects of Specialized’s international marketing communications efforts. Chip then spent the next four-plus years in a variety of marketing and sales consulting engagements with firms both inside and outside the recreation marketplace before joining SOAR Communications in 2005.
Chip earned his bachelor’s degree in Business Management from Brigham Young University, and his MBA from Pepperdine University. He also lived in Tokyo, Japan for a year and half, where he learned the Japanese language.
He moved to Salt Lake City, Utah in 2004 where he lives, skis, and rides with his wife, Debbie.
Maura Lansford, Account Executive
Maura started her career in the fast-paced world of technology PR after earning a degree in Communications from Brigham Young University-Idaho. When presented with an opportunity to work with self-proclaimed ski bums, roadies and tree huggers, Maura jumped at the chance to join a more relatable crowd.
Now a SOAR veteran of more than four years, Maura boasts an impressive electronic rolodex of media contacts from her time managing media registration, and writing and placing stories for the industry’s most influential outdoor recreation, home fitness, fly fishing and cycling tradeshows. She’s also spent her fair share of time organizing and producing product-and event-focused television segments and seasonal gift guides.
Whether swimming at the family cabin in Montana, skiing at Snowbird or pushing a stroller around the neighborhood park, Maura enjoys spending time outside with her young family and friends.
Alex Strickland, Account Executive
Alex comes to SOAR with a combination of media and marketing experience and a love for playing outside. As an active mountain biker, skier and marketing professional and a recovering runner and newspaperman, Alex brings a unique perspective gained from years working in and with the media and enjoying the outdoors in all seasons.
At SOAR, Alex helps promote the products and public involvement of cycling apparel maker Primal Wear, provides public relations services to non-profit Bikes for Kids Utah and assists in media relation and promotion for Outdoor Retailer and Interbike, two flagship trade shows in their respective industries.
Alex was a small-town newspaper editor in Western Montana where he photographed, wrote, designed and managed two weekly newspapers that covered more than 350 square miles and a dozen communities. His experience also includes stints as a news editor and senior writer in the marketing departments at a pair of state universities and as an accounts manager and production designer at FUEL Marketing a Salt Lake City-based advertising agency.
In addition to his full-time professional work, Alex is a freelance writer and photographer and his writing and photography has been published in numerous print and online publications across the country including WashingtonPost.com, Montana Magazine, Outdoor Informer.com, Empire Builder magazine, NewWest.net and others.
